Norza makes U-turn, will remain BAM president


PETALING JAYA: Tan Sri Norza Zakaria will not be stepping down from his position as president of the Badminton Association of Malaysia (BAM) this month.

Norza had decided to resign from his post earlier in the year but has now made a U-turn after holding discussions with Youth and Sports Minister Hannah Yeoh and the other BAM council members.
